Excavation has transcended the days of merely moving earth. Advances in technology have introduced new methods and tools that improve precision and reduce the environmental impact. One major innovation that has significantly impacted the industry is 3D modeling and GPS technology. Dutch Mountain Excavating has embraced these innovations, enabling them to perform tasks with greater accuracy. The integration of 3D models helps create precise plans, which reduces the likelihood of encountering unexpected obstacles during excavation.
GPS technology, when paired with excavation equipment, allows operators at Dutch Mountain to achieve exacting standards. By using GPS-guided systems, excavation becomes more precise, minimizing waste and reducing the time required to complete a project. The landscape is surveyed in real-time, ensuring that the project sticks to plans and adjusts quickly to any necessary changes.
The use of machine control systems is another game-changer in the excavation industry. These systems have automated many of the manual tasks involved in traditional excavation, translating into improved safety and productivity. At Dutch Mountain Excavating, implementing machine control systems has reduced the margin of error while enhancing operational safety—a crucial factor when working on large-scale projects. By automating routine processes, workers can focus on other critical tasks that require human judgment, thus optimizing the entire workflow.

Safety, always a top priority in manufacturing and construction, has also benefitted from technological advancements. Through the use of drones for aerial surveys and inspections, Dutch Mountain ensures safety protocols are strictly followed without compromising on the thoroughness. These unmanned aerial systems can access hard-to-reach areas, providing detailed views that were once impossible to achieve safely.
